Development of education in Garo Hills: continuity and change
Hill societies, their modernisation : a study of north east with special reference to Garo Hills • New Delhi • Published In 1995 • Pages: 187-196
By: George, Mathew.
AbstractBrief abstract written by HRAF anthropologists who have done the subject indexing for the document
This is a history of the educational system in the Garo Hills. It begins with a description of the traditional system of teaching based in the bachelor houses (NOKPANTE), and continues with the history of the various schools established by the Baptist and Catholic Missions, and government from 1826 to 1981. Some early Garo graduates of the mission schools founded their own schools and played an important role in expanding the educational system.
